Can individuals with high blood glucose consume liangfen?

Generally speaking, individuals with elevated blood glucose may consume liangfen in moderation. While there are no absolute dietary prohibitions, intake must be carefully limited. Liangfen is typically made from starchy ingredients such as mung bean starch, pea starch, or sweet potato starch. Therefore, portion control is essential: when consuming liangfen, other staple carbohydrate sources (e.g., rice, noodles, bread) must be correspondingly reduced. Because liangfen is rich in starch—which is readily digested and absorbed and rapidly converted into glucose—it can cause a sharp postprandial rise in blood glucose. To minimize its impact on glycemic control, strict portion limitation is crucial.

Individuals with hyperglycemia need to pay special attention to their diet. They should avoid foods high in sugar or cholesterol, spicy or irritating foods, and alcoholic beverages. Only by maintaining appropriate dietary habits can blood glucose be effectively controlled and further elevation prevented.

It is recommended that individuals with high blood glucose adhere consistently to healthy dietary principles: controlling total caloric intake, adopting a pattern of smaller, more frequent meals, regularly monitoring blood glucose levels, and taking prescribed antihyperglycemic medications as directed by their physician.
